
Field Technician – Traveling

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in New Jersey, +1 more state.
• Install, maintain, and service poles, solar panels, batteries, and camera systems at a variety of customer locations.
• Install poles of different lengths according to specifications, ensuring minimal digging for post holes.
• Mount solar panels and external batteries; install and align LPR cameras utilizing PTZ technology.
• Conduct both installations and maintenance, with approximately equal distribution between the two (50/50 split).
• Operate on public and private roadways, often working on equipment positioned 10–12 feet high.
• Utilize ladders and bucket trucks to safely perform tasks at heights of up to 30 feet.
• Employ power and hand tools; repair minor damages in underground irrigation or private wiring systems.
• Drive company vehicles and tow small trailers; support DFR (Drone as First Responder) teams and mobile security trailers.
• Meet with clients to conduct site surveys and discuss potential installation options.
• Interpret traffic control plans and permit drawings to determine compliant installation sites.
• Monitor inventory, receive shipments, and upload installation photos and updates through the Flock Field mobile app.
• Execute all tasks in a safe, professional, and compliant manner.
• Adapt to changing schedules, often with a notice period of 2–3 days.
• Must be comfortable with physical work, including lifting up to 50 lbs, climbing, and working outdoors.
• Preferred experience in construction, electrical, low-voltage wiring, or similar hands-on positions.
• Strong mechanical aptitude and familiarity with tools and equipment are essential.
• Ability to work independently across diverse job types and environments.
• Must be comfortable driving vans and trucks, as well as towing small trailers (must be 21+ with a valid driver’s license).
• Basic computer and mobile app proficiency; willingness to learn new technologies.
• Must be flexible, reliable, and adaptable to shifting priorities.
